If I recall correctly, discos stop your accrual when they happen. So for example if you had one kill, two assists and had damaged a few other enemy mechs then get zapped and quite to pilot a different mech in a new game, you get xp and pay for what you accomplished to the point you quit. But if your team ended up winning, killed the mechs you damaged for more assists, et.c after you left you will not get any of the xp or cbill payout for events that occurred after you disconnect.
